It might still not fix itself, but there is/was a job queue issue [1]. Look at
the graph for the last week/last month, it's slowly been building up. Similar
will have occurred for other wikis, though, probably nowhere near the same
extent

Roan has restarted a few stuck job runners, and this seems to be now processing
through the queue

The job queue itself is not guaranteed to run a job (there's a bug logged about
that), but it should do at least some of it. Hence, with the noted growth over
the last week (time of rename), there's no point putting any effort into
directly fixing the symptoms till the cause had been fixed.

It seems to be doing around 10k jobs an hour now, so after 8 or 9 hours (and
make sure the queue is nearly [or totally] empty), if it's still an issue, this
can be investigated further. Certainly at this point, there's no reason for
anyone to believe the rename won't happen with the job queue batch processing
now occurring
